Uzbekistan. RoHS is mandatory for market access
On February 17, 2026 new RoHS Technical Regulation will come into force in Uzbekistan. The Cabinet of Ministers of the Republic of Uzbekistan approved the Technical Regulation "On Restricting the Use of Hazardous Substances in Electrical and Electronic Products." (No. 517 of August 15, 2025). The document establishes uniform mandatory requirements for restricting the use of hazardous substances in electrical and electronic products placed on the market of the Republic of Uzbekistan.
Scope
The RoHS regulation limits the concentration of ten hazardous substances — lead, mercury, cadmium, hexavalent chromium, PBB, PBDE, DEHP, BBP, DBP, DIBP — to 0.1 % by weight in homogeneous materials (cadmium 0.01 %).
It applies broadly to household appliances, lighting equipment, IT and telecom devices, cables, and low-voltage components.
The list of electrical and electronic products subject to mandatory conformity assessment is provided in Appendix 1 to the RoHS Technical Regulations and includes such product categories as:
- Electrical appliances and devices for food preparation and storage, kitchen mechanisation, and other kitchen equipment
- Electrical appliances and devices for:
- processing (washing, ironing, drying, cleaning) linen, clothing, and footwear
- cleaning and tidying premises
- maintaining and regulating the indoor microclimate
- Electrical appliances and devices for:
- sanitary and hygienic
- hair, nail, and skin care
- body heating
- gaming, sports, and exercise equipment
- audio and video equipment, television and radio receivers
- household sewing and knitting machines
- gardening
- aquariums and garden ponds
- Power supplies, chargers, and voltage stabilizers
- Light sources and lighting equipment, including equipment built into furniture
- Electric toys
- Electronic computers and connected devices, including combinations thereof
- Cash registers, ticket printing machines, ID card readers, ATMs, and information kiosks
- Cables, wires, and cords intended for use at a rated voltage of no more than 500 V AC and/or DC, with the exception of fiber optic cables
- Automatic switches and residual current devices
- Electrical devices for controlling electrical appliances
- Telecommunications equipment (terminal telecommunications devices), including landline and mobile telephones, automated telephones, fax machines, and telex machines
- Gaming and vending machines
- Fire, security, and fire-security alarms
Out of the scope
- Those used for national defense, law enforcement agencies, and as special technical means for operational investigative measures
- Equipment intended for use at a rated voltage exceeding 1,000V AC and 1,500V DC
- Intended for use as components of electrical equipment not specified in the list of the Technical Regulations
- Photovoltaic panels (solar batteries)
- Products intended for use in ground-based and orbital space objects
- Electrical equipment intended exclusively for use in air, water, underground, and land transport
- Electric batteries and accumulators intended for use in electrical and electronic products
- Used equipment
- Large stationary industrial equipment
- Measuring instruments
- Medical devices
- Specially designed equipment for research and development
Compliance is confirmed through declaration of conformity or certification.
A separate RoHS certificate is not required as an independent document: RoHS requirements are integrated into the product’s main certificate. Test reports from accredited test laboratory will be accepted. Certificates with RoHS technical regulation will be issued from February 17, 2026, so from January 2026 please add RoHS TR in your application forms and we will add RoHS TR in the product main certificate.
Certificates issued before February 17, 2026 remain valid until their stated expiry.
To enter Uzbekistan market manufactures and importers must get approvals for Safety, EMC, RF and RoHS technical regulations.
